Single Page Applications (SPAs) are web applications that provide a native app-like experience by dynamically updating the content of a single HTML page as the user interacts with the app.
They are built using modern web technologies, such as JavaScript, HTML, and CSS, and offer many benefits over traditional multi-page web applications.
Improved user experience: SPAs provide a seamless and responsive experience for users, as the content updates dynamically without the need for full page reloads.
Faster load times: SPAs are optimized for fast load times, as they only need to load the required content for each page.
Cross-platform compatibility: SPAs are compatible with a wide range of devices and platforms, including desktops, laptops, tablets, and smartphones.
Efficient data management: SPAs can efficiently manage data on the client-side, reducing the need for server requests and improving performance.
Easier maintenance: SPAs are easier to maintain than traditional multi-page web applications, as they only have a single HTML page to manage.
Better scalability: SPAs can handle increasing amounts of data and users more efficiently than traditional multi-page web applications.
SPAs are suitable for a wide range of applications, including e-commerce, media and entertainment, travel, and finance. They can help businesses improve user engagement, increase conversions, and reduce development and maintenance costs.
A good Single Page Application (SPA) service provider should have expertise in developing SPAs, experience with industry-specific requirements, and the ability to deliver high-quality results. The provider should also be able to offer support and maintenance services for the SPA after launch.